VINCENT – The Vincent Yellow Jackets improved to 2-1 overall record with a 52-19 victory over Pleasant Valley in their home opener on Friday, Sept. 14.

Vincent (1-1 in Class 2A, Region 6) jumped out to a 19-6 lead in the first quarter, then added eight more points in the second to take a 27-13 lead at halftime.

The Yellow Jackets defense shutout Pleasant Valley (1-2) in the second half while the Vincent offense scored 21 points in the third and seven points in the fourth to secure the 52-19 win.

Rodney Groce led the Yellow Jackets with 178 yards rushing on nine carries with three touchdowns. Senior quarterback Damauntey Johnson added 100 yards rushing with two touchdowns while throwing for 205 yards on just 5-of-8 passing. Michael Gilham added a rushing touchdown for Vincent.

Anterio Rogers led Vincent with 91 yards receiving with two scores.

The Yellow Jackets racked up 583 yards of total offense in the victory, 380 of which came on the ground.
